1. That feeling you get that you just can't describe, you know? It's a combination of amazing, fantastic etc.

2. Sacha.
Person 1: OMG that weave is so amataz.
Person 2: Yeah, talking of weaves,I have a bit of one in my pencil case.

Person 1: Who is the most amataz person in the world?
Person 2: Why did you even bother to ask that?
Person 1: Sorry, I had a brain fart, of course it is Sacha.
by Amataz October 29, 2008
an undescribably great (as in positive) thing
amataz (v.)
"today was so amataz"
"that's so amataz"
by cynthia on October 24, 2008